Commit f5f902e
authored
VED-1044: Create Cloudwatch Dashboard with Parameterised Terraform (#1226)
* Set up imms-metrics-dashboard-dev with json file
* Add condition to not re-deploy dashboard upon a PR
* Generate alarms based on env
* Parameterise DynamoDB Reads and Kinesis
* Tidy up dynamodb metrics and parameterise Kinesis and SQS
* Organise terraform file to match layout of dashboard
* Set up lambdas grouped by area and update widget positioning
* Add lambda metrics for API, batch and Ancillary
* Self review
* Fixes from terraform plan
* Add ElastiCache CPUUtilization
* Fix widget positioning
* Update alarms widget height
* Add Redis lambdas to dev
* Address review comments: Refactor sub environment vars, add comments, typos
* Review comment. Remove duplicate queue metric for non dev environments1 parent 2a1a63c commit f5f902e
1 file changed
Lines changed: 732 additions & 0 deletions
0 commit comments